The RTLA Story: From Mandate to Movement
The story of RTLA Church is not just about buildings or timelines—it’s about a divine call, a deep internal shift, and a bold vision to reform culture and restore hearts.
Pastors Javier and Cynthia Buelna have been on a journey together since the age of 15—now 34 years strong, parents to three adult children, and proud grandparents of three. Their story is a living example of faithfulness , leadership, and mission.
In 2004, God gave them a mandate: build the church. They obeyed—not fully knowing how much more God would do. What began as an assignment has since become a movement. Over time, what they built has grown into something far greater: a church that looks like heaven—bilingual, multicultural, multiethnic, and multigenerational.
The early years were marked by painful pruning. RTLA had to unlearn religion to relearn relationship. As the church transitioned from legalism and tradition to authenticity and grace, attendance declined—but the culture was being purified. What felt like struggle was actually sacred formation.
By 2014, the shift became visible. A fresh wind blew through RTLA: new mindsets, new leaders, and a restored sense of identity. The church began to thrive—not because of hype, but because of health.
⸻
Who We Are Today
RTLA Church isn’t just a place—it’s a presence. We are a community of reformers, soul-healers, creatives, and culture-shapers committed to building lives, families, and futures that reflect the heart of God.
In 2024, due to continued growth and the expanding impact of our ministry, we moved to the El Segundo Performing Arts Center. This move is more than a new space—it’s a prophetic picture of elevation and expansion. It’s a home that matches the magnitude of the mandate.
We lead church, culture, and family with the same conviction:
•Authenticity over appearance
•Wholeness over hype
•Formation over performance
•Legacy over trends
What started as a mandate to build a church has become a movement shaping lives, leaders, and generations. From South Central to El Segundo—and to the world—RTLA is reforming culture, reaching people, and training leaders—one life at a time
